Broiled Apples and Pears with Rosemary

Servings: 12

 

Ingredients:

4 Bosc pears, unpeeled, halved, cored, thinly sliced lengthwise

1 tablespoon minced fresh rosemary

1/4 cup extra-virgin olive oil

4 Golden Delicious apples, unpeeled, halved, cored, thinly sliced lengthwise

Equipment:

broiler

baking sheet

bowl

Cooking instruction summary:

Preparation Preheat broiler. Brush 2 large baking sheets with olive oil. Gently toss apples, pears, 1/4 cup oil, and minced rosemary in large bowl. Arrange fruit in single layer on sheets. Broil until fruit is tender and edges begin to brown, watching closely to avoid burning and turning sheets for even browning, about 5 minutes. Transfer fruit to platter. Sprinkle with pepper. Garnish with rosemary sprigs, if desired. Serve warm or at room temperature. (Can be prepared 4 hours ahead. Let stand at room temperature.)
